Star Refrigeration goes back on the road

UK: Star Refrigeration is to host two seminars in Scotland in June to inform industrial refrigeration and heating equipment operators on energy efficiency, technology developments and regulatory and legislative responsibilities.

The half-day, free-to-attend CPD seminars and Q&A sessions, taking place in Aberdeen and Glasgow, are targeted at those working in cold storage, food and drink manufacturing, HVAC, ice rinks, pharma and petrochemical industries. Attendees will have the opportunity to participate in the innovative talks and there will be time to discuss specific topics with experts during one-to-one sessions.

Star will be sharing knowledge and practical advice on the current issues facing the cooling industry. Star is inviting attendees to recommend topics they would be interested in to ensure operators get the most out of the event, and receive valuable insights to improve their businesses. Feedback can be recorded when booking a place online. Star’s team will then tailor the content of the sessions to include the most popular topics.

The European Commission’s recently published draft F-gas revision proposal is likely to be a hot topic for businesses using heating and refrigeration plants. Star has planned seminars around the refrigerant phase-out and legislative compliance, future refrigerants available to users, heat pumps and advice on improving refrigeration plant energy performance and working toward net zero targets.

The Star 2022 Roadshow takes place on 14 June 2022 at Curl Aberdeen, and 16 June 2022 at the Best Western Moorings Hotel, Glasgow from 09.00 to 13.30. Both events are free to attend, but registration must be made in advance.
